Transaction 604f94fe529d693d4cbb762d24abfa13802255a3d57761a37f1cb06ef783353e

block
93c376530f5ee45fd85d0b6060e559db259a5a7778d83edf87e1823c4cab3cf1

1 Input

23 Outputs